Faculty: The course is industry-relevant and practical. Academics are strong and supportive. Faculty members are qualified and helpful. There are merit-based scholarship options available. The fee is moderate (around 1.5 Lacs per year). Faculty qualifications include Ph.D. and Master’s degrees. The teaching method is interactive and hands-on. Term exams are timely and moderately difficult. The fee hike policy is reasonable (5-10% yearly increment). The cost to study is around 6-7 Lacs for 4 years. Schola...

To get into Mohamed Sathak A J College of Engineering for a BE/BTech course, candidates must meet the eligibility criteria set by the college. Students must pass Class 12 with a minimum of 45% aggregate. For detailed eligibility students can check the table presented below:

Course NameEligibility 
General Category45.00%
Backward Class including Backward Class Muslim40.00%
MBC & DNC40.00%
SC / SCA / ST40.00%
